In 2011 Serbia arrested and delivered Ratko Mladić, the former commander of Bosnian Serb troops, to the tribunal in The Hague. The author argues that this act confirms Serbia’s cooperation with the international tribunal, which was one of the main conditions for its integration with the EU.
